Understanding Membership Perks Usage


Membership perks come in many forms: discounts, early access, special events, personalized services, and more. To maximize these perks, you first need to understand what is available and how to access them.


  • Review your membership details carefully. Many programs provide a welcome packet or an online portal where you can see all benefits.

  • Set reminders for time-sensitive offers. Some perks expire quickly or are available only during certain periods.

  • Use apps or websites linked to your membership. These platforms often have exclusive deals or notifications about new perks.


For example, a retail membership might offer 10% off every purchase, but also flash sales and birthday discounts. Knowing when and how to use these can multiply your savings.

Strategies for Effective Membership Perks Usage


To truly maximize your membership perks usage, consider these strategies:


  1. Plan your purchases or activities around perks. If your membership offers discounts on specific days, schedule your shopping accordingly.

  2. Combine perks with other promotions. Some memberships allow stacking discounts with coupons or seasonal sales.

  3. Engage with the community. Many memberships include access to exclusive forums, events, or networking opportunities that add value beyond discounts.

  4. Track your usage. Keep a simple log of perks used and savings gained to identify which benefits are most valuable to you.


For instance, if you have a travel membership, booking flights or hotels during member-only sales can save hundreds of dollars. Additionally, attending member-exclusive events can provide unique experiences not available to the general public.


How to Identify High-Value Perks


Not all perks are created equal. Some may seem attractive but offer little real benefit. To identify high-value perks:


  • Calculate the actual savings or value. A 5% discount on a small purchase might be less valuable than a free service or exclusive access.

  • Consider your lifestyle and preferences. Perks related to your hobbies or needs will be more beneficial.

  • Look for perks that offer convenience or time savings. Sometimes, skipping a line or getting priority service is worth more than a discount.


For example, a gym membership that includes free personal training sessions might be more valuable than one offering only discounted merchandise if you want to improve your fitness.

Tips for Sharing Membership Perks with Family and Friends


Many memberships allow sharing benefits with family or friends. This can increase the overall value and strengthen relationships.


  • Check the membership terms for sharing policies. Some programs allow multiple users or guest passes.

  • Coordinate usage to avoid overlap. Plan who uses which perk and when.

  • Gift perks for special occasions. Sharing exclusive event invitations or discounts can be a thoughtful gesture.


For example, a dining membership might offer a free meal for a guest. Inviting a friend or family member to join you can make the experience more enjoyable and cost-effective.


Keeping Your Membership Active and Up-to-Date


To continue enjoying your membership perks, it is important to keep your membership active and stay informed about updates.


  • Renew your membership on time. Set calendar alerts to avoid lapses.

  • Update your contact information. This ensures you receive all communications about new perks or changes.

  • Provide feedback to the membership provider. Sharing your experience can lead to improved benefits or personalized offers.


By staying engaged, you ensure you never miss out on valuable opportunities.
